Se connecter à une base [ORACLE] - SQL/NoSQL - Programmation
Marsh Posté le 24-09-2007 à 13:15:55
je ne comprends pas trop ce que tu veux faire.
De ce que j'ai compris, tu veux voir les utilisateurs qui se connecte à la base de données? C'est bien cela?
L'outil ENTRERPRISE MANAGER que tu peux installé avec le client ORACLE te permet de voir les sessions actuelles et donc d'avoir ces informations.
Pour te connecter à une base de données, il faut toujours un login et un password.
Marsh Posté le 24-09-2007 à 15:05:39
Je suppose (mais pas sûr) qu'Oracle permet comme certains autre SGBD, d'exécuter une série de commandes automatiquement au moment de l'ouverture de session.
Des variables systèmes doivent contenir entre autre l'IP du client ainsi que le nom d'utilisateur ayant ouverte la session.
Donc tu peux creuser de ce côté pour allimenter une table ou un fichier texte de cette façon.
Marsh Posté le 24-09-2007 à 16:08:12
Moi ce que je comprends c'est qu'il n'a pas les identifiants de connexion à oracle, et que donc il est baisé.
Mais je peux me tromper.
Marsh Posté le 24-09-2007 à 16:29:06
system/manager en parant du principe que l'admin du serveur est une grosse quiche avec le QI d'une moule frite surgelée (c'est à dire 99,9% des serveurs dans la monde, au boulot ça marche sur toutes les instances d'Oracle ).
Marsh Posté le 24-09-2007 à 16:33:43
MagicBuzz a écrit : system/manager en parant du principe que l'admin du serveur est une grosse quiche avec le QI d'une moule frite surgelée (c'est à dire 99,9% des serveurs dans la monde, au boulot ça marche sur toutes les instances d'Oracle ). |
Marsh Posté le 24-09-2007 à 16:41:18
"i agree > next > next > next > end"
bon ben voilà, c'est installé configuré, ça fera 3000 €.
Marsh Posté le 24-09-2007 à 18:02:08
Rigolez pas... en projet (scolaire) le gas qui s'occupaire de la BDD Oracle, ben il a laissé le mot de passe par défaut. Mais chuuutteeee.
Sinon, je n'ai effectivement pas de login/mdp. Mais je vais essayer system/manager
Là il est l'heure de rentrer.
A+
Marsh Posté le 25-09-2007 à 08:36:50
bah si t'as un accès root, tu peux te connecter à la base sans mot de passe
il suffit d'être dans le groupe système "dba" (ou autre suivant l'installation) si t'es sous unix, ou ORA_DBA sous windows
Ensuite tu te connectes sans mot de passe via la commande
Code :
|
et voilou
Marsh Posté le 25-09-2007 à 14:41:35
find / -name sqlplus, le répertoire bin d'oracle est p-e pas dans ton path...
Marsh Posté le 25-09-2007 à 14:46:36
En effet... j'y avait pas pensé... je vais checké ça de suite.
Marsh Posté le 25-09-2007 à 15:15:05
Code :
|
Bon... je dois spécifier mon ORACLE_HOME où se situe un fichier sp1<lang>.msb. Or il y a un fichier dans OraHome1/sqlplus/mesg/.
Enfin bon... je ne sais pas trop quoi faire là...
Marsh Posté le 25-09-2007 à 16:32:55
Merci à tous et surtout à couak!
Je suis enfin connecté à la BDD.
Marsh Posté le 24-09-2007 à 10:07:05
Bonjour à tous,
J'ai un petit soucis avec un serveur qui héberge une bdd Oracle.
But: voir les utilisateurs qui ont accès à la bdd. Voir qui s'y connecte encore.
Moyen: accès root sur le serveur qui héberge la bdd. Pas de login/mdp pour la bdd.
Est-ce possible? Si oui comment? Via les fichiers de config et tout dans le répertoire d'Oracle.
Merci d'avance.